KOHAT: Security personnel destroyed more than 30 bunkers and caves during a search operation in an area between Darra Adamkhel and Orakzai Agency late on Saturday night.

According to officials of the tribal administration, the security forces carried out the day-long operation after getting a tip that militants had turned the region, known as Tora Cheena, into a sanctuary from where they carried out attacks on security forces.

And in Mohmand Agency, the security forces gunned down five suspected militants after fighting off an attack on a checkpost on Saturday.

In the search operation near Darra Adamkhel, the bunkers, caves and hideouts were demolished and a bomb disposal squad exploded the ammunition found there.

The sources said the militants moved between the Frontier Region of Kohat and Lower Orakzai from their camp in Tora Cheena and carried out terrorist activities.

The place was also used for training militants.


5 suspected militants gunned down in Mohmand Agency


The operation was conducted following the repatriation of over 15,000 displaced families to their homes in Orakzai Agency after eight years.

Fauzee Khan Mohmand adds from Ghalanai: At least five militants were killed as security personnel repulsed an attack on their post in Khwezai area of Mohmand Agency on Saturday night.

According to officials, militants attacked the Yaqobi post in the border area with heavy weapons.

Security personnel deployed at the post killed five attackers and injured several others. The other militants escaped.

SOLDIER KILLED: A soldier was killed and another injured after an improvised explosive device went off at Soran Darra, in Baizai area of Mohmand Agency.

According to security sources, personnel of the army’s bomb disposal squad were patrolling the area when the explosion killed Lance Naik Wazir Khan and injured Sepoy Khuram, who was airlifted to Peshawar.

Later security forces conducted a search operation in nearby areas, but made no arrests.

CURFEW: Owing to worsening law and order situation, authorities and security forces imposed a curfew in Dawezai and Sagai areas and banned motorcycle riding in the tribal region.

Announcements to this effect were made from mosques in various areas and bazaars.
